Today’s Summer Guide Pick: Despicable Me at Bellevue Summer Outdoor Movies in the Park

By Seattle Met Staff July 12, 2011

From the Seattle Summer Events Guide:

So…the weather’s not exactly great right now. But if you miss tonight’s Bellevue Summer Outdoor Movies in the Park screening of Despicable Me, know that four other neighborhoods plan to show the (very popular) animated comedy this summer. Grab a blanket or a lawn chair and head to Bellevue Downtown Park before dusk to get a prime spot. Films are free, but there’s a collection for a local charity at each screening; tonight’s suggested donation items are gift cards and hygiene products for the Sophia Way.
